在点播的F_2代,采用含有共同母本“Gelenlea”的三个春小麦(Tritcum aestivum L.)杂种,在众多的选择标准中评价了把生产率、产量指数和株高用作选择标准以便识别出高产的F_4代集团的价值。试验表明,利用生产率这一指标能从点播的群体中选出具有高产潜力的高秆品种;而利用产量指数这一指标能从点播的群体中选出半矮秆(矮秆)品种。因此,对于选择具有高产潜力的品种来说,对高秆的F_2代植株可把生产率作为选择标准;对矮秆的F_2代植株可把产量指数作为选择标准。这些结果表明,把生产率、产量指数和株高结合起来进行春小麦的产量选择,是很有用的。
In the on-demand F2 generation, the three triticale (Triticum aestivum L.) hybrids containing the common mother “Gelenlea” were evaluated in many selection criteria using productivity, yield index and plant height as selection criteria to identify high yield The value of F_4 generation group. Experiments show that using the index of productivity can select the high-stalk varieties with high yield potential from the on-demand groups, while using the index of the yield index can select the semi-dwarf (dwarf) varieties from the on-demand groups. Therefore, for the selection of cultivars with high yield potential, the production rate could be taken as the selection criterion for the high-yield F2 generation plants and the yield index for the dwarf F2 generation plants as the selection criterion. These results indicate that it is useful to combine the productivity, yield index and plant height for spring wheat yield selection.
